jnxSpSvcSetName
|
jnxSpSvcSetEntry 1
|
A text name for the service set.
|
|
jnxSpSvcSetSvcType
|
jnxSpSvcSetEntry 2
|
The name of the service type associated with the service set.
|
|
jnxSpSvcSetTypeIndex
|
jnxSpSvcSetEntry 3
|
An integer used to identify the service type for the service
set.
|
|
jnxSpSvcSetIfName
|
jnxSpSvcSetEntry 4
|
The name of the interface identifying the Adaptive Services
PIC. If more than one interface is associated with the Adaptive Services
PIC, the name associated with the lower layer interface is used.
|
|
jnxSpSvcSetIfIndex
|
jnxSpSvcSetEntry 5
|
An index number associated with the interface name.
|
|
jnxSpSvcSetMemoryUsage
|
jnxSpSvcSetEntry 6
|
Amount of memory used by the service set, in bytes.
|
|
jnxSpSvcSetCpuUtil
|
jnxSpSvcSetEntry 7
|
Amount of CPU processing used by the service set, expressed
as a percentage of total CPU usage.
J-series Services Routers do not have a dedicated CPU for services.
CPU usage on these routers appears as 0.
|
|
jnxSpSvcSetSvcStyle
|
jnxSpSvcSetEntry 8
|
Type of service for the service set. Service types include:
-
Unknown—The service type is not known.
-
Interface-service—The service is interface
based.
-
Next-hop-service—The service is next-hop
based.
|
|
jnxSpSvcSetMemLimitPktDrops
|
jnxSpSvcSetEntry 9
|
Number of packets dropped because the service set exceeded its
memory limits (operating in the Red zone).
|
|
jnxSpSvcSetCpuLimitPktDrops
|
jnxSpSvcSetEntry 10
|
Number of packets dropped because the service set exceeded the
average CPU limits (when total CPU usage exceeds 85 percent).
|
|
jnxSpSvcSetFlowLimitPktDrops
|
jnxSpSvcSetEntry 11
|
Number of packets dropped because the service set exceeded the
flow limit.
